Affecting people has been a lot of things over the course of this century. Now, those media were thought to be a great, almost inescapable effect, then again, they considered that virtually nil. And because "new media" always emerged, the cycle "much power - little power - still a lot of power" seemed to repeat repeatedly. There is an extensive literature on this subject, but it is hardly possible to overlook and, moreover, often gave rise to major speech and mind confusion. The working of mass media provides an extremely clear overview of the literature on the influence and function of mass media and mass communication. The various insights are discussed and numerous researches are being conducted
Referenced results. The authors show that the history of effect thinking follows a retrospective pattern. Furthermore, they further emphasize that older philosophical future reflections on media use and culture seem to coincide with recent communicative scientific research results. J. G. Stappers is professor of communication science at the University of Nijmegen. A. D. Reijnders and W A. J. Móller studied this subject and, after graduation, worked for the Institute for Mass Communication for some years as a researcher / employee. Stappers previously published Mass Communication. An introduction, four of which appeared.
